On the way back we detoured thru West and had a view of the devastation caused by the fertilizer plant explosion. The site of the plant explosion was pretty much cleaned up. One school had nothing but a concrete slab , the other still vacant and lot's of houses are being rebuild or replaced. It was different than I expected after seeing it on TV.
